Unless Mike has changed his molds around dramatically, he sells the E46 nose that most of the kits went out with, or, he sells a "VERSION" of an E36 nose that incorporates a wide and deep undertray, as well as a front lip or splitter.
This nose incorporates the kidney grill, full bumper cover, and matches his fenders pretty well.
It does NOT however look "just like" an E36 PTG car did. The E36 PTG cars mimic the M3 LTW in overall size and shape, with a flat bottom, and a "blank" usually in the middle filled up, and often painted black.
ABLOriginalParts.com or Don has some photos of the MaShaw E36 styled bumper cover of which I speak...and you can see the differences when you look, they are particularly apparent on the sides where the fenders flow into the bumper covers.
Mike's fenders are dramatically different from PTG as well, and designed to match asthetically the rear fenders, and more importantly get rid of a gap that would be virtually insurmountable above the tires in front without dramatic chassis corrections. (in a word, you can't slam an E36 in front and expect it to perform unless you do a lot... and even then you'd better know what you're doing. They tubbed their cars in front I believe towards the end)
